The weather will be nice--hopefully you can get and outdoor table at Txikito. It's right about your price range as well, assuming you're sharing a bottle or two of wine. I think it's excellent. Don't miss the Arraultza pintxo (sofrito, palacios chorizo, fried quail egg on top). We always order the salt cod croquettas, blistered peppers, and fries with cod mayo. I like the suckling pig special a lot as well. They have a number of specials on the blackboard each day. Also the torreja (french toast) dessert is great.
